Abstract

The embodiment of the invention discloses a cultural relic identification method and device based on artificial intelligence, equipment and a storage medium, and the method comprises the steps: obtaining digital data of a to-be-identified cultural relic, the digital data comprising at least one of image data and instrument detection data; extracting features of the to-be-identified cultural relicsaccording to the digital data to form a feature set; inputting the feature set into a neural network model generated by preset training for feature mutex judgment, wherein the neural network model isobtained by training from a historical database; and outputting the mutually exclusive features judged in the feature set so as to manually confirm the mutually exclusive features, preliminarily solving the problem that in the prior art, common collectors and investors have relatively weak identification capability on cultural relics through artificial intelligence-based identification.

technical field [0001] The embodiments of the present application relate to computer intelligence technology, and in particular to methods, devices, equipment and storage media for cultural relic identification based on artificial intelligence. Background technique [0002] With the rapid development of the economy, the cultural field is becoming more and more active. On the one hand, many people are buying and selling cultural relics more and more in order to satisfy their own collection hobbies, and on the other hand, as an investment behavior. [0003] With the increasing prosperity of the cultural relics market, many counterfeiters of cultural relics have produced imitations or counterfeit cultural relics that cannot be recognized by ordinary investors through superb skills, and put them into the collection market, which seriously disrupted the standardized operation of the collection market and brought great benefits to collectors and investors.
